Host AP is considered among the most famous device drives for the Linux operating systems. It usually works with the help of cards with the Conexant Prism chip. Its major task is to support the host AP mode which permits wireless local area network to connect and perform all the required functions. It is one of the most efficient drivers to speed up the IEEE 802 access points.

How Host AP Works?
Host AP(wireless is constructed on the Linux personal computers circuits which makes it similar to the most of the commercial access points, it is considered that is supports the uplink created by the wired connection of internet wit totally wireless connection. this is widely used by the different kinds of various clients such as business and individuals. When the proper connection is constructed between internet and clients then it transfers the data in the form of packets from wired to the wireless connection and also from the wireless to the concerned wired point as required by the client.
Construction of Host AP:
Following are the required step for constructing the Host AP in the Linux operating system in order to make it more efficient. According to the requirement the connection is created just similar to the setup of wireless sniffer Then the SUSE Linux operating system is installed correctly in the computer system. After the installation the prism driver is updated or it may be replaced with the new version to become highly efficient during working. Proper interface configuration file is created for the data travel with the help of wired adapter. Required configuration with the connection id done for the start up of original path way of data. Configuration is handled with the help of appropriate data codes that are typically designed for this very task. DHCPD is properly created and configured to initiate the real time transmission from wired to wireless and vice versa. Finally connection is shared for the data travel.
